serum potassium

Potassium is an electrically charged mineral that the heart relies on to fire and recover its beats. The body keeps blood potassium within a narrow band, because both too little and too much can disturb the heart's electrical rhythm — sometimes dangerously.

Inside heart cells, potassium movements help generate each electrical impulse and reset the cell afterward. When blood potassium drops too low (hypokalemia) or climbs too high (hyperkalemia), these electrical events misfire, which can produce abnormal rhythms ranging from extra beats to life-threatening ventricular arrhythmias and even cardiac arrest.

Potassium levels are routinely checked in heart patients because many common cardiac drugs — diuretics, ACE inhibitors, and others — push the level up or down, and because kidney problems impair its control. Severe abnormalities can show characteristic ECG changes, and dangerous values are treated promptly to protect the heart.

A blood sample handled roughly or left too long can leak potassium from cells and give a falsely high reading, so a surprising result is sometimes rechecked.
